Ready to wear
(129)
- Ready to wear (129)
BELTS
ANKLE BOOTS
TRENCH COATS
MIDI SKIRTS
MINI SKIRTS
WIDE LEG TROUSERS
SHORTS
SHORT OUTERWEAR
MIDAXI
BELTS
ANKLE BOOTS
TRENCH COATS
MIDI SKIRTS
MINI SKIRTS
WIDE LEG TROUSERS
SHORTS
SHORT OUTERWEAR
MIDAXI
mala skirt
£345
eola SKIRT
£195
vinie coat
£370
assia skirt
£440
toya skirt
£175
vivy trousers
£230
donna trousers
£205
tanais pea
£420
maxou jacket
£1,160
melvin jacket
£1,160
malicia skirt
£205
muse coat
£365
meona skirt
£195
pippa skirt
£450
ioul shorts
£175
tolling coat
£420
pona skirt
£400
alexa skirt
£240
skad trousers
£260
ainara coat
£400
abiss skirt
£205
belt BETIVER
£170
cayrel skirt
£205
payton skirt
£260
slopa skirt
£185
volentia skirt
£205
cadwin trousers
£230
valentia skirt
£205
friea skirt
£205
sulyvan skirt
£450
rosalia skirt
£335
kara coat
£450
mellou wide-leg
£190
sama trousers
£230
polar coat
£345
simos skirt
£185
math skirt
£185
faye skirt
£400
sulina trousers
£270
suez skirt
£240